Transaction 95591871726f65b605b4ac91ba1e27bac978af8b9aab55e208a2608809343802
1 Input
1 Output
-
95591871726f65b605b4ac91ba1e27bac978af8b9aab55e208a2608809343802:0
- value
- 1998611
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 967a2297af78a87875b75cdeab1faba460e22cd8 OP_EQUAL
- address
- 3FQfbR4iYaVqCRhU6gYe6zxZGCcg74t3Qm